My Kronos x has been packed away for almost two years due to other priorities.
I successfully upgraded it to v3.04, when playing all sounds there seems to be a doppler, rotary effect on all sounds and i just can`t get rid of it.

All suggestions on how to get rid of this "effect" would be gratefully received.

I don't know exactly.

Press your Kronos Joystick up or down to see if that turns off rotary. Could be a simple pedal setting you have pointing to the Joystick.

Also, under Global/Basic I do see some check boxes for "Effect Global SW"

Mine are not checked so I am not sure how they play out.

Look into that on your Kronos.

Then go to the German Grand program, Ctrl view effect Tab.
See what effect is in the ' on ' position

I'm wondering if MIDI is the issue - Sometimes I've found that midi will trigger internally AND externally which causes audible phasing. You might have turned that off at some point and the update reset it back to normal.

Try disconnecting the MIDI cables and see if it still sounds the same.

Also, does it do the same thing via headphones as well?

Could it be that your headphones are not inserted fully or are faulty? The effect you're describing sounds like what happens when only the right output is going through.

Hi Greg,

You were absolutely right, i missed the Global audio page, the input fx had the chorus switched on.
